We continue with the decade of the 70s and find Mike Oldfield, Aphrodite's Child and after his separation Vangelis and Demis Rousos Vangelis:  In any case, the diversity and complexity of the work contained in his discography makes it difficult to catalog him as a purely New Age artist, since he is even considered one of the pioneers of the avant-garde of electronic music born in the mid-1970s. Of my: After the dissolution of Aphrodite's Child, Demis continued recording sporadically with his bandmate, the also outstanding musician Vangelis. They recorded together in 1977 the Magic album whose biggest success was "Because", known in Spanish as "Die next to my love" and recorded in seven languages ??in total.
